Overview

The LFE5UM-45F-8BG381I is a member of the Lattice ECP5 FPGA family, designed for high-performance connectivity in a cost-optimized architecture. It features 44,000 logic elements and nearly 2 Mb of embedded RAM, making it suitable for applications requiring high-speed data processing and flexible I/O connectivity.

Why Choose This Part

This FPGA offers a high ratio of logic cells to power consumption, operating at a core voltage of 1.045V to 1.155V. With 203 available I/O and integrated SERDES, it provides significant connectivity options for bandwidth-intensive designs within a compact 17x17mm footprint.

Key Specifications

Mounting Type Surface Mount
Number of I/O 203
Package / Case 381-FBGA
Total RAM Bits 1990656
Voltage - Supply 1.045V ~ 1.155V
Number of LABs/CLBs 11000
Operating Temperature -40degC ~ 100degC (TJ)
Supplier Device Package 381-CABGA (17x17)
Number of Logic Elements/Cells 44000

Getting Started

Development is supported by Lattice Diamond design software, which provides tools for synthesis, placement, and routing. Engineers can utilize the ECP5-5G Development Kit to prototype high-speed interfaces and evaluate the SERDES performance before final board design.
